Details
A vulnerability classified as critical was found in iText up to 5.5.11/7.0.2. Affected by this vulnerability is an unknown functionality of the component XML Parser. The manipulation as part of a PDF Document leads to a xml external entity reference vulnerability. The CWE definition for the vulnerability is CWE-611. The product processes an XML document that can contain XML entities with URIs that resolve to documents outside of the intended sphere of control, causing the product to embed incorrect documents into its output.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
The XML parsers in iText before 5.5.12 and 7.x before 7.0.3 do not disable external entities, which might allow remote attackers to conduct XML external entity (XXE) attacks via a crafted PDF.
The bug was discovered 11/06/2017. The weakness was presented 11/08/2017 as not defined posting (Bugtraq). It is possible to read the advisory at securityfocus.com. This vulnerability is known as CVE-2017-9096 since 05/19/2017. The attack can be launched remotely. The exploitation doesn't need any form of authentication. The technical details are unknown and an exploit is not publicly available.
The vulnerability was handled as a non-public zero-day exploit for at least 2 days. During that time the estimated underground price was around $0-$5k.
Upgrading to version 5.5.12 or 7.0.3 eliminates this vulnerability.
